Mesothelioma Compensation

Expenses associated with mesothelioma add up quickly. Compensation from a trust fund, a lawsuit or VA benefits may help offset costs.

A reputable mesothelioma lawyer will look over your military or work history to determine if and when exposure to asbestos is likely to have occurred. They can also provide information on different types of compensation.

How much money can I receive?

Asbestos-related victims are entitled to compensation for medical expenses loss of wages, pain and suffering. The amount of compensation offered depends on each victim's circumstances. Mesothelioma patients may also be eligible for punitive damages, which are additional payments to punish defendants for their actions. A knowledgeable mesothelioma lawyer will assist clients in determining whether an agreement or trial is the best option for them.

A seasoned attorney can help a client receive the most amount of amount of compensation. However, attorneys cannot guarantee the amount of a settlement. There are many variables, such as the particular mesothelioma type and the time frame since the patient was diagnosed. The amount of compensation received may be impacted by the number of asbestos-related companies who are accountable.

The majority of mesothelioma lawsuits are settled rather than going to trial. A case can take many years to be heard. A trial allows a jury to determine whether defendants are owed compensation from victims and how much they are due.

Veterans Affairs can provide benefits to victims of asbestos-related diseases and mesothelioma in addition to monetary compensation. These benefits could include access to the top mesothelioma experts and disability compensation. A lawyer can assist veterans with their VA claims.

A veteran's attorney can also help them file an injury-related lawsuit against the asbestos-related businesses responsible for their mesothelioma or another diseases. A mesothelioma lawsuit is not a replacement for filing an VA claim.

What Compensation is Available?

Mesothelioma compensation covers a range of costs. Compensation may include medical expenses, lost wages, and home care costs. It could also cover non-tangible losses such as pain and discomfort. Mesothelioma lawyers may be able to help you calculate the compensation amount.

The most commonly filed asbestos claims are personal injury and wrongful death lawsuits. A top mesothelioma lawyer can examine your case for free and recommend the best kind of compensation claim to make. They will gather evidence, such as your employment history and asbestos exposure dates. They can also access large databases of asbestos-producing firms.

When asbestos's dangers were well-known, a number of companies that produced asbestos-containing items went under. These companies created asbestos trust funds to ensure that their victims would be compensated. These funds, which contain around $30 billion and are used to pay mesothelioma patients, without having to go to court. The amount of mesothelioma settlements and jury verdicts is higher than the asbestos trust fund payouts.

In addition to seeking compensation through an asbestos attorney trust fund, certain victims and their families are also eligible for financial aid through government programs. Veterans diagnosed with an asbestos-related illness are eligible for disability benefits through the U.S. Department of Veterans Affairs. The amount of compensation is determined by the severity of the mesothelioma, or any other asbestos legal-related disease.

Family members of mesothelioma survivors may also qualify for compensation based on estate or wrongful death claims. Asbestos-related victims could also be eligible for community assistance or other benefits through their employer or the military.
